Responsibilities

Responsible for compliance with applicable policies and procedures
Performs skilled calibrations/services on M&TE according to written policy and procedures
Performs repairs on all types of M&TE
Processes electronic work orders, house requisitions, miscellaneous purchase orders and various other administrative activities that support daily job functions. Appropriate documentation of calibration work orders with accuracy and timeliness
Communicates, through various means, such as email, voicemail, and maintenance management system (Maximo) the status of ongoing calibration/repair activities
Completes all necessary qualifications on documents including calibration procedures and standard operating procedures in a timely manner. Completes all necessary training requirements including scheduled training, computer based, and any other training identified in development plan
Develops recommendations for solving M&TE hardware and measurement problems. Develop techniques as necessary to ascertain that newly acquired or developed M&TE performs in accordance with required specifications
Assists in establishing and documenting appropriate job plans, data sheets, and other service protocols that may be required
Ensures that GxP and safe work policies and procedures are followed and maintained at all times in accordance with established company policies
Other responsibilities and duties as assigned by Group Leader, Supervisor, or Senior Supervisor

Qualification

GMP/GLP practicesInstrumentation troubleshootingLaboratory instrumentationProcess control systemsTeam environment

Required

Recommend a high school education with a minimum of 4 years of related work experience
Comparable military service training may be acceptable if it is directly applicable to the job assignment
Education, experience and related military service will be evaluated on an individual basis
Must have knowledge of various laboratory, research & development, or process instrumentation
Expertise in GMP/GLP laboratory practices
Must be skilled in troubleshooting various instrumentation utilizing schematics and flowcharts
Ability to learn quickly, the theory and operation of newly purchased M&TE for analytical or process control systems
Capability to work within and promote a team environment
